摘要
In this paper, a CPW fed sleeve monopole antenna is proposed. The proposed CPW fed antenna is easy to be integrated with radio frequency/microwave circuitry for low manufacturing cost. The antenna, which occupies a small size of 36(L) x 32(W) x1.6(H) mm(3), is simply composed of a monopole and sleeves. By carefully selecting the lengths and heights of monopole and sleeve, good pass band characteristic of antenna can be obtained, so that operating band covering 3.15 GHz to 4.3 GHz can be achieved. The simulated results also demonstrate that the proposed antenna has good radiation patterns with appreciable gain across the operating band and is thus suitable to be integrated within the portable devices for WiMAX applications.
